Output d8b2a9c5c3b896af8634db8b1704f6dabf8ea43ef3bba59c616742de6851ebbd:24

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4b20f95687d5c7a4f40d4f0f63cd4f05ee40cb43fcac82fa7597b102099158c4
address
bc1pfvs0j4586hr6faqdfu8k8n20qhhypj6rljkg97n4j7csyzv3trzqan4scl
transaction
d8b2a9c5c3b896af8634db8b1704f6dabf8ea43ef3bba59c616742de6851ebbd